instana-agent-ansible

Статус сборки

:warning: :warning: :warning:

Этот репозиторий является шаблоном, который демонстрирует, как установка и настройка агента Instana могут быть автоматизированы с помощью Ansible, и предназначен для того, чтобы другие могли клонировать и развивать его. Он не поддерживается активно. Если вы добавили новый функционал в своем форке, который, по вашему мнению, может быть полезен для других, свяжитесь с нами, чтобы мы могли добавить ссылку на него отсюда.

:warning: :warning: :warning:

Роль instana-agent-ansible

Эта роль Ansible устанавливает, настраивает и запускает агент мониторинга для набора инструментов мониторинга Instana. Вы можете найти роль в Ansible Galaxy по адресу https://galaxy.ansible.com/instana/instana-agent-ansible.

Чтобы установить роль, используйте команду ansible-galaxy install instana.instana-agent-ansible.

Вот пример плейбука с различными параметрами конфигурации:

Пример:

---
  - hosts: all
    become: yes
    roles:
      - instana.instana-agent-ansible
    vars:
      instana_agent_flavor: "dynamic"
      instana_agent_jdk: "/opt/jdk"
      instana_agent_updates_enabled: yes
      instana_agent_updates_interval: "DAY"
      instana_agent_updates_time: "04:30"
      instana_agent_zone: "prod"
      instana_agent_agent_key: <ВАШ_КЛЮЧ_АГЕНТА_INSTANA>
      instana_agent_endpoint_host: <ВАШ_ЭНДПОЙНТ_РЕГИОНА:saas-us-west-2.instana.io>
      instana_agent_endpoint_port: 443

Варианты

instana-agent-dynamic

Этот пустой агент поставляется с JDK и настроен на загрузку всех необходимых сенсоров при запуске. Кроме того, он настроен на обновление своего набора сенсоров ежедневно.

instana-agent-static

Этот "ограниченный" пакет агента не должен подключаться к интернету. Он поставляется со всеми последними сенсорами и JDK и является вашим выбором, когда у вас жесткая настройка межсетевого экрана.

Мониторинговый эндпоинт

Если вы клиент, использующий локальные серверы, укажите ваш хост и порт в соответствующих атрибутах. Если вы используете наше SaaS-предложение и не знаете, на какой эндпоинт агент должен отправлять данные, не стесняйтесь обращаться к нашей команде продаж.

Поддерживаемые операционные системы

См. нашу официальную документацию.

Атрибуты

Лицензия и авторы

Этот плейбук подается и поддерживается в соответствии с Лицензией Apache v2.0.

Авторские права 2018, INSTANA Inc.

О проекте

Instana is the next generation Application Performance Management solution that automatically monitors scheduled environments/dynamic modern applications. Instana comprehensively manages the quality of service of your microservice applications with zero t

Установить
ansible-galaxy install instana/instana-agent-ansible
Лицензия
apache-2.0
Загрузки
9114
Владелец
Instana observability by IBM